Company Picnic Activity Ideas for Adults and Kids
Since most company picnics involve not only the employees but also their children and spouses, it's important for you to plan family friendly events the entire family will enjoy. This is where the challenge comes into the scene. It's nearly impossible to address the desires and interests of all company employees and their families. Some may be young and fit and others might be nearing retirement. So, plan on offering a multitude of events for every age group.
Games For The Adults
For adults and older employees, trivia or Bingo are great activity options. If you arrange a trivia game, think about structuring it like "Jeopardy" or "Who Wants To Be A Millionaire" for more fun. Remember to include questions of all skill levels and from all topic areas. If you'd like something a little lighter hearted, consider setting up a game of Bingo instead. You can contact local businesses to ask for gift certificate donations to give away as prizes.
Sporting Activities
To add a little team spirit to your company picnic, why not plan a sporting event? You can always plan for a game of volleyball, softball or badminton if you have enough employees and guests to form teams. Or, you can do something simpler like a three legged race or a relay race.
Rent An Inflatable
If you want to offer something easy to plan that offers amazing appeal to kids, renting an inflatable bounce house is a great idea. Inflatables are ideal for those who want to plan a stress free company picnic because the rental company does all of the work for you. They will deliver the inflatable, set it up and come back when the event is over to take it down and haul it away. Kids will stay entertained for hours and adults can join in the fun in most cases, too.
Overall, as long as you provide activities that will entertain all age groups of attendees, your company picnic will be a raging success!

Easy Games To Set Up For Your Summer Carnival
Carnival games don't have to be elaborate to allow your guests to have a good time. In fact, sometimes the simplest games bring the most joy! Kids really don't care much about the game itself, but more about a prize they might win. So, be sure to stock up on small prizes and candy to give out to all players.
1) Wet Sponge Toss: This game can be constructed by using a garbage can lid and large wet sponges. Basically, you need one volunteer to be the target and that person defends himself with the garbage can lid while the player gets three chances to hit the target with the wet sponges. This can be loads of fun, even for the person playing the target role!
2) Bounce House Or Inflatable Slide: If you want something effortless at your carnival, think about renting an inflatable slide or bounce house. These activities are guaranteed to be thrilling to all guests and are very reasonably priced. In addition, the rental company will deliver the item, set it up and come back to pick it up.
3) Penny Splash: This fun event requires you to set up a fish tank filled with water only. Place two or three tall glasses in the bottom of the fish tank, so they are sunk into the water and sitting upright. Place a bowl of pennies on the table beside the tank and allow each player to drop pennies into the tank, giving a prize to anyone who has a lucky penny drop into a glass.

Great Party Planning - Renting Tents, Tables and Chairs
Any quality professional event plannerwill tell you, renting tables, tents and chairs for an event is one of the most essentials steps of the event planning process. While the guests might be the main feature of any party they must have a place to gather, a place to sit or a place to eat while at the event. If they don't, your event will be a bust. The rental process of tables, chairs, and tents might be quite boring but it's a process you don't want to leave until the last minute.When thinking of tables, tents, and chairs for your event you can start off by deciding whether you need to purchase them or rent them. This decision is huge, considering the financial difference between the two options. If you're a professional party planner or event planner you might be tempted to buy them to help you utilize them for future events. However, they are quite expensive to purchase and after the purchase also need you to have a large area for their storage between events. Thus, it's usually much better to rent tables, tents and chairs instead of buying them.
You will generally find that renting is an inexpensive option. Of course just like anything else, you will find differing prices, but even limited budgets are sure to find an option that suits them.
Base prices for table and tent rentals include:
* Tent Price Rental: $200 - $259 for 20x20 to $1,100 for 20x100
* Patio Table Umbrella Rentals: $7-$10
* Table Rental Prices: $7-$12
* Banquet Table Rental Prices: $8-$15
Just about the most important aspects of renting tables, chairs, and tents is how many you'll need. To figure this out, make sure to start by thinking about how many people you've invited. The average event has a 40% turnout which is something to think about. Next, think about how many people have confirmed their attendance and who they will be bringing. Then add about 5%-10% to that number because you will see guests who simply don't confirm but still arrive.

Five Excellent Party Decorating Hints
When you enter an event, the image you first get upon entering is very important for the entire mood of the event. Decorations for an event can vary greatly, from using lights and streamers to more elaborate decorations like scene settings. When decorations are done properly they can set a beautiful scene for kids birthday party guests to enjoy, which is their exact purpose.Preparing for a special event can be fun, but it is also overwhelming. Therefore, such preparations must start as early as possible to allow for time and eliminate problems that are certain to occur.
If you're planning party, use these decorating tips. A number of them are very commonly known and others are not. Of course, all of these tips will help you greatly!
* One important tip to remember is to keep all utility cables outside the tent area. This is vital because if they are underneath the tent they could cause a fire and they can also cause guests to trip and fall.
* To avoid another potential fire hazard, be sure you keep all flammable decorations away from electrical outlets, lights and electrical cords.
* Set food tables underneath canopies or inside tents as opposed to out in the open. Should rain fall or heavy winds pick up, the food could splatter before being consumed. Besides, enclosing food within walled or meshed tents can reduce the chance of attracting flies and other unwanted critters.
* To avoid getting a cluttered look, make sure not to over decorate. If you over-decorate you'll distract your guests from interacting with one another and create a cluttered environment that will make many people very uncomfortable. Before you've done too much, be sure to take a breath, look around and stop!

Types of Interactive Inflatable Activities for Get-Togethers
Inflatable Game Ideas for Parties
Planning any party can be tough, especially with regards to planning the entertainment. Inflatable activities are an ideal choice because they let people of every age have fun. There are many inflatable games to choose from that go beyond the typical bounce houses that most people think about at kid's parties.
If you're responsible for planning a kids birthday party , celebration a family picnic, a church event or a carnival, you may well be wondering what family friendly activities and games you should include. You'll want to stick with your budget but also offer activities the entire family can enjoy together.
Inflatable activities seem like games just for kids, but this isn't true. You can play many inflatable games for everyone. Consider some excellent ideas for inflatable activities you could play at parties for people spanning various ages.
Sumo wrestling is one of the most well known forms of inflatable activities for adults. With this game, people put on inflatable sumo suits and then try to knock each other over. Once someone falls down, they will have a hard time getting back on their feet. This game works at parties that are both indoors and outdoors.
Another choice in inflatable games is human bowling. No matter what age you are, it is fun to roll someone down a bowling lane and then try to knock over bowling pins. However, this inflatable activity requires a relatively large space so it often works best for outdoor parties.
During the hot summer days, a good idea for inflatable games is the inflatable slip and slide. This isn't exactly like the game you remember from your childhood. Rather it provides hours of fun for people of all ages and is a terrific way to cool down on a hot summer day.
The last option is the rock-climbing wall. While this isn't exactly an inflatable activity, it is made of molded plastic. Along with this being a game popular with people spanning various ages, it also provides good physical activity. This is a small enough activity that can also be played in small yards.
